Books for Amma’s followers and Muslims

Bhagavad Gita in Urdu

Just a few days ago, while distributing books in shops, Acarya Prabhu came to a hall where Amritamayi Amma's followers had gathered for a program given by her representative.

There was a big picture of Amma. Acarya decided to show a Srimad Bhagavatam set to Amma's representative, and surprisingly she was interested in the books and asked others present how many funds they had. When informed that they had enough funds, she bought the set. At the end, each of them took a volume of Srimad Bhagavatam to their home to read. It was a surprise and a good way to make these people devotees of Krishna.

Also, in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h, forty-two percent of the population are Muslims. On the order of Srila Prabhupada, our spiritual master, Bhakti Vikasa Swami Maharaja, reminded us to distribute books also to the Muslims. Srila Prabhupada will definitely be pleased and bless our endeavours if a Muslim becomes a devotee of Krishna.

Recently, the Indian BBT published a new Urdu edition of Bhagavad Gita. So we ordered some and are distributing them to Muslims. Some are buying, and some are very tough. But after many difficult days of going through the Muslim shops, our devotees are feeling very strong and purified.
